Nothing like enjoying Ice Cream when you know they basically make it right next door. I think the DeLuxe creamery is attached to this space. They make the DeLuxe brand and also Front Porch ice cream that you can find in grocery stores in the area. I go here as often as I’m able(given that it’s about 30 mins from my house). Super charming inside. Clean and new, but designed to evoke some of that old style soda fountain feel. Neat placemats on each table with original instructions from classic soda fountains on how to make various floats, malted milks, etc. Very cool little touch. They aren’t doing Green Tea Fennel or any other off the wall type flavors, but they have a boatload of interesting flavors, mostly the classics. And it’s right in the heart of downtown Mooresville, which is just a great, classic, and vibrant Southern downtown. Check it out.
